package org.mycore.common.function;
import java.util.Objects;
import java.util.function.Consumer;
/**
* Represents an operation that accepts two input arguments and returns no result. This is the three-arity
* specialization of {@link Consumer}. Unlike most other {@link FunctionalInterface functional interfaces},
* MCRTriConsumer
is expected to operate via side-effects.
*
* This is a {@link FunctionalInterface functional interface} whose functional method is
* {@link #accept(Object, Object, Object)}.
*
*
* @author Thomas Scheffler (yagee)
*/
@FunctionalInterface
public interface MCRTriConsumer {
/**
* Performs this operation on the given arguments.
*
* @param t
* the first input argument
* @param u
* the second input argument
* @param v
* the third input argument
*/
void accept(T t, U u, V v);
/**
* Returns a composed MCRTriConsumer that performs, in sequence, this operation followed by the after operation. If
* performing either operation throws an exception, it is relayed to the caller of the composed operation. If
* performing this operation throws an exception, the after operation will not be performed.
*
* @param after
* the Operation to perform after this operation
* @return a composed MCRTriConsumer that performs in sequence this operation followed by the after operation
* @throws NullPointerException
* if after is null
*/
default MCRTriConsumer andThen(MCRTriConsumer after) {
Objects.requireNonNull(after);
return (a, b, c) -> {
accept(a, b, c);
after.accept(a, b, c);
};
}
}
